The Dot & Key Watermelon Cooling Sunscreen SPF 50 is a gel-format, broad-spectrum sunscreen built for daily use on the face, neck, and body. Carrying an SPF 50 rating and a PA+++ shield, it targets both UVA and UVB exposure across all skin types. Three active ingredients define this formula: watermelon, hyaluronic acid, and UV filters. Watermelon targets dullness and uneven skin tone and texture. Hyaluronic acid delivers lightweight hydration, contributing to the dewy, silky finish reviewers describe without adding greasiness or heaviness. The UV filters deliver the SPF 50 and PA+++ broad-spectrum protection. The gel-cream texture absorbs quickly, keeping the product non-sticky and non-greasy on the skin. The formula is PABA-free, paraben-free, fragrance-free, and non-comedogenic. It carries a cruelty-free designation and suits adults across all skin types, including oily, combination, and sensitive skin.
Oily and combination skin types benefit most from this sunscreen. Reviewers note consistent oil control and comfortable daily wear in hot, humid conditions, with the finish sitting well under makeup. Users across a range of skin tones report no white cast, a key factor for Indian skin. That said, the irritation score of 45 reflects real concerns. Some reviewers report burning, redness, and itching after application, suggesting this may not suit all sensitive skin types despite the spec listing. Patch-test before committing if your skin runs reactive. Multiple reviewers also report the sunscreen does not hold up against sweat or water, with one noting breakdown within 15 minutes of swimming. For outdoor or high-sweat activity, frequent reapplication is essential.

Apply this sunscreen as the last step of your morning skincare routine, giving it a few minutes to absorb before stepping out. For continuous outdoor exposure, reapply every two hours for maintained protection. Reviewers note the gel texture absorbs quickly and layers well, making reapplication practical even over light makeup.
Yes. The sunscreen carries a non-comedogenic designation, meaning it does not clog pores, and the specs confirm it suits oily and combination skin types. Reviewers with oily skin report effective oil control and comfortable wear in hot, humid conditions. The gel-cream texture absorbs quickly without leaving greasiness or residue.
The formula includes hyaluronic acid as an active ingredient. It functions as a humectant, drawing moisture to the skin surface and providing lightweight hydration without heaviness. This contributes to the dewy, silky finish reviewers consistently describe, and keeps the formula from feeling drying despite its oil-control properties.
The specs list dark spot correction and uneven skin tone treatment among the product benefits, attributed to the watermelon ingredient in the formula. Cosmetic actives of this kind typically require consistent daily use over several weeks before visible improvement appears. The review insights cite no specific timeline, so results will vary by individual.
The formula is fragrance-free and paraben-free, which reduces common irritant risk, and the specs list sensitive skin as a compatible type. However, some reviewers with sensitive skin have reported burning, redness, and itching after use. If your skin is reactive, perform a patch test on a small area before applying to your full face.
This sunscreen offers SPF 50 and a PA+++ rating, providing stronger UVB protection and greater UVA shielding than a basic SPF 30 formula. The PA+++ rating matters in India's high UV index environment, where UVA exposure contributes to tanning, dark spots, and long-term skin ageing. The active ingredient stack, including watermelon and hyaluronic acid alongside UV filters, goes beyond the protection-only scope of a basic sunscreen.
